The old Royal Salop Infirmary

Shrewsbury, England

The old Royal Salop Infirmary was constructed as a subscription hospital for the people of Shropshire in 1830. It served the community through cholera and flu epidemics, and of course through two major world wars. By 1915 crude steel and glass balconies had been added to the rear to allow Great War patients to enjoy the River view and the Second World War brought an operating theatre suite constructed on the roof. The closure in the mid 1970s due to the construction of a new hospital allowed the building to take on a new identity as the ‘Parade Shopping Centre’.
